Technical Parameters and Chemical Composition
ZhenAn provides a range of industrial SiC grades, typically categorized by their SiC purity to suit different furnace requirements (EAF, BOF, or Induction).
| Component | Industrial Grade 88% | Industrial Grade 90% | Industrial Grade 95% |
| SiC Content | ≥ 88.0% | ≥ 90.0% | ≥ 95.0% |
| Free Carbon (F.C.) | ≤ 4.0% | ≤ 3.0% | ≤ 2.0% |
| Fe2O3 | ≤ 2.0% | ≤ 1.5% | ≤ 1.0% |
| Moisture | ≤ 0.5% | ≤ 0.5% | ≤ 0.3% |
| Al2O3 | ≤ 1.5% | ≤ 1.2% | ≤ 0.8% |
Key Industrial Applications: Steel, Casting & Refractory
1. Steelmaking Deoxidation
Industrial SiC is an effective deoxidizer for molten steel. It reacts with oxygen more vigorously than ferrosilicon at high temperatures, leading to cleaner steel with fewer non-metallic inclusions.
2. Iron Foundry Inoculant
In gray and ductile iron casting, SiC acts as a powerful nucleating agent. It promotes the formation of graphite flakes or nodules, improving the mechanical properties and machinability of the final casting.
3. Refractory Raw Materials
Because of its high melting point (approx. 2700°C) and resistance to thermal shock, industrial SiC is widely used in making furnace bricks, kiln linings, and crucibles.
4. Slag Conditioning
It helps in maintaining slag fluidity, making the tapping process smoother and reducing the loss of valuable alloys into the slag.
How Industrial SiC Optimizes Smelting Costs
The use of Industrial SiC provides a clear economic advantage through its "dual-alloying" effect:
Carbon and Silicon Recovery: One unit of SiC provides both silicon and carbon, replacing the need for separate additions of petroleum coke and ferrosilicon.
Exothermic Energy: The chemical reaction of SiC in the melt is exothermic, which helps maintain the liquid temperature and reduces the electricity consumption of the furnace.
Higher Yield: Faster deoxidation leads to a higher recovery rate of other noble alloys like manganese or chromium.

Available Forms: Lumps, Briquettes, and Grains
To accommodate various charging systems, ZhenAn offers industrial SiC in multiple physical forms:
SiC Lumps (10-50mm): Best for initial charging in Electric Arc Furnaces (EAF).
SiC Grains (1-10mm): Ideal for ladle additions and induction furnace charging.
SiC Briquettes: Compressed balls (e.g., 50x30mm) for easy handling and uniform melting.
SiC Powder: Fine mesh for specialized refractory mixing or coating.
